Subject: [PATCH -next 5/6] ext4: avoid to double free s_mmp_bh

If call read_mmp_block failed then s_mmp_bh will be freed in read_mmp_block.
Kmmpd wait to be killed, ext4_stop_mmpd stop kmmpd and also release s_mmp_bh.
To avoid double free, just set EXT4_SB(sb)->s_mmp_bh with NULL.

Signed-off-by: Ye Bin <yebin10@huawei.com>
---
 fs/ext4/mmp.c | 1 +
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)

diff --git a/fs/ext4/mmp.c b/fs/ext4/mmp.c
index 2a1473e4a9de..eed854bb6194 100644
--- a/fs/ext4/mmp.c
+++ b/fs/ext4/mmp.c
@@ -218,6 +218,7 @@ static int kmmpd(void *data)
 				ext4_error_err(sb, -retval,
 					       "error reading MMP data: %d",
 					       retval);
+				EXT4_SB(sb)->s_mmp_bh = NULL;
 				goto wait_to_exit;
 			}
